What are the seller's obligations in sales contracts in Paraguay regarding the delivery of goods?
The seller's obligations in Paraguay regarding the delivery of goods are regulated by Law No. 1334/98 on Consumer Protection. The seller has the obligation to deliver the goods in the agreed conditions, complying with the delivery terms and any other agreed conditions. Additionally, you must provide clear information about the delivery process. If the seller does not comply with these obligations, the consumer has the right to demand compliance or, in serious cases, terminate the contract and receive a refund.

What legal recourse do taxpayers have to challenge tax decisions in Colombia?
In Colombia, taxpayers have the right to challenge unfavorable tax decisions. They can file appeals for reconsideration before the DIAN and, if necessary, appeal to judicial authorities. The contentious-administrative jurisdiction is responsible for resolving tax disputes. It is essential to have specialist legal advice when challenging tax decisions to maximize the chances of success and ensure compliance with established legal procedures.
